HVAC Service in Cardington, OH: What to Expect

Cardington sits just northeast of Columbus, and the central Ohio climate delivers the kind of temperature swings that test every HVAC system. Summers push into the mid-80s with real humidity, while January averages hover around 22 F, meaning residents need reliable heating when the wind bites and dependable cooling when the heat index climbs. This year-round demand is why HVAC Service in Cardington matters so much to local homeowners. The area supports eight contractors with an average rating of 3.7 across roughly 425 reviews, a decent pool of options but one where quality varies enough that choosing wisely matters.

Costs in this market follow predictable patterns. A standard service call or diagnostic runs $75-$200, while a routine tune-up for a single system typically costs $70-$200. When something breaks down, standard repairs can range anywhere from $150 all the way up to $1200 depending on what fails and what parts are needed. These numbers reflect the real cost of keeping systems running in a climate that demands both serious cooling capacity and serious heating muscle. In Ohio, contractors must hold a valid HVAC contractor license from the Ohio Construction Industry Licensing Board, and commercial work requires an additional state license.
